Staff presented the quarterly capital improvement projects report: Sterling recycling center completion, River Bend stream restoration and stormwater work, EV charging phase progress, fire and rescue stations under construction, and upcoming road/intersection projects.

Loudoun County’s capital programs office presented its quarterly update on capital improvement projects, showing completed, in-progress and upcoming work across county facilities and transportation projects.

Key highlights: staff reported completion of perimeter plantings at the Sterling recycling center and said the center is fully planted and operating. The River Bend stream and outfall restoration and its paved walkway and bridge reopened in time for the school year.
